La chapelle Sixtine est l'une des chapelles les plus célèbres au monde, célébrée pour ses extraordinaires fresques de Michel-Ange, dont La Création d'Adam et Le Jugement dernier. Lors de votre visite libre, prenez le temps d'admirer le plafond et le mur de l'autel à votre rythme. Veuillez noter que le silence est requis et que la photographie n'est pas autorisée à l'intérieur de la chapelle.

Informations importantes
- Déconseillé aux voyageurs avec des problèmes cardiovasculaires
- Convient à toutes les conditions physiques
- Code vestimentaire : Les épaules et les genoux doivent rester couverts.
- ID valide: Les voyageurs doivent être munis d'une pièce d'identité valide.
- En raison de la réglementation des musées du Vatican, nous ne sommes pas en mesure d'accueillir des personnes handicapées.
